Personal photos are often taken because people like to keep memories alive and share with others. Anyone who considers themselves a shutterbug may have more pictures than they can handle and possibly get misplaced. People like this find that complete scrapbook kits helps them to organize and sort precious photographs better than traditional albums and storage boxes.
Some people think that scrapbooking is about embellishments and placing stickers on photos. There are some kits on the market that not only helps to keep pictures organized but also have themes that are not considered frilly or feminine. These include branches of the military, the outdoors, traditional holidays, and other special events that can be enjoyed by anyone.
The advantage of using a kit is that users have everything they need to create something unique because the memories are personal. These kits make it easy for the person who may not work with crafts often and everything included is made to place the user at ease. Many include simple instructions that show people how to make something that is fabulous.
Those who do not care for the decorating aspect may find that these help to organize photos and create relevant captions. This cannot always be done with traditional photo albums as some will are not designed to hold the paper without mess or page yellowing that comes with age. Most scrapbooking kits can handle just about any medium and they make viewing easier.
They can also be used to teach younger users about organization and history. Sometimes viewers can learn about the behind the scene events that were going on at the time the photo was taken. This can evolve into a series or ongoing story that is not limited to a date stamp or a simple saying that gives the viewer little to go on when they are reading.
There are many choices for kits on the market today and these have few limitations. When using copies of pictures, there are other crafting ideas that are fairly easy to make at home and do not require any special equipment or training. Pictures may be used as part of ebooks, picture gift boxes, and other crafts that are functional and cost little.
Many are beginning to choose digital scrapbooking as a way to create picture books as software has become user friendly as well as affordable. The end result allows users to create and edit pages that have a wide variety of uses. These do not require special training or advanced computer knowledge. With these kits, photos can be shared with others as well as make customized gifts.
Some people have also found unusual themes for their scrapbooks in recent. Events like divorce, former job that was less than pleasant, or winning the lottery have been used as a theme, which some may find therapeutic. Whatever the reason, scrapbooks are fun to have around, whether they are made with fabric, paper, or stored on a hard drive.
